Your Responsibilities as a Production Manager

  • You ensure the crews are briefed, organized, they have all their necessary equipment and on the road each morning on time. Team Members have the training they require, identifying and resolving any training issues that may arise to ensure quality of work. Keeping dedicated team members by continuing a healthy team environment and keeping people accountable.
  • Regular on the ground supervision of job sites to ensure it's done to The Grounds Guys standards and within the customers contract including following up on any concerns from the customer or team members.
  • Implementing The Grounds Guys franchise systems effectively and efficiently throughout the business including timesheets has been adequately filled in with correct times, photos and notes detailing the work completed, review daily targeted onsite times, unbillable times (% maximum) and quality of work.
  • Ensuring the shop, yard, trucks and trailers are neat, tidy, well organized and stocked. Managing equipment maintenance including repairs on all tools, equipment, vehicles whether ordering and following up with the vendor or sending it to a qualified mechanic.
  • Are comfortable taking over additional leadership responsibilities when another manager is away.

How We Measure Success

  • Attendance & Strong Communication:

Might sound basic, but it's critical to meet our Customer Service goals. This is a full time position, summer is mostly weekends off, when we switch to winter 24/7 on-call availability from October 15th - April 30th since winter storms don't take weekends off

  • Budget vs Actual Hours: Keeping jobs profitable is dependent on managing the time planned and spent at each job.
  • Return Rates: You'll ensure quality control to make sure it's rare to ever need to go back to redo a job.
  • Customer Retention: Building great relationships with each customer, and ensuring that they receive exceptional service, will keep them coming back.
  • Full Utilization of Software & Processes: This helps make all of the above possible.

Ideal Candidate for a Production Manager

  • Enjoy being part of a team, ability to teach, mentor and motivate team members with a friendly and positive outlook on life!
  • Good Communication skills, is able to problem solve; make quick informed decisions but asks if they have questions, with attention to the details
  • Valid Drivers licence
  • 3+ years experience in landscaping or another highly detailed outdoor profession.
